Hi,
You can charge your Braille Note without opening your case. Just
plug
the charger into the normal slot on the back of your unit. there
is a
hole in the case made specifically for that purpose.
If you are having problems with your Braille Note falling out of
your
case then it is a problem with the way you are using the case
with
your Braille Note.
When closed properly you really can't loose it.
